#3a0604 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3a0604 is composed of 22.7% red, 2.4%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.7% magenta, 93.1% yellow and 77.3% black. It has a hue angle of 2.2 degrees, a saturation of 87.1% and a lightness of 12.2%. #3a0604 color hex could be obtained by blending #740c08 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

#3a0604 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3a0604 has RGB values of R:58, G:6,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.9, Y:0.93, K:0.77. Its decimal value is 3802628.

Shades and Tints of #3a0604
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030000 is the darkest color, while #fef0f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3a0604
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#201e1e is the less saturated color, while #3c0402 is the most saturated one.
